        <RULE_TITLE>McGovern-Dole International Food for Education and Child Nutrition (McGovern-Dole Program) Program and Food for Progress (FFP) Program</RULE_TITLE>
        <ABSTRACT><![CDATA[The McGovern-Dole Program helps promote education, child development, and food security for some of the worlds poorest children.  It provides for donations of U.S. agricultural products, as well as financial and technical assistance for school feeding, and maternal and child nutrition projects in low-income countries.  The FFP is targeted to countries that are making strides toward democracy and private enterprise.  The program emphasizes private sector agricultural and economic development and enhanced food security in recipient countries.

This final rule amends the regulations at 7 CFR parts 1499 and 1599 used to administer the McGovern-Dole Program and the FFP, respectively, by removing obsolete references to offices within the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A), and by making revisions to provide greater clarity with respect to all aspects of the program, with specific emphasis on:  The eligibility requirements that a participant must meet and the actions that must be undertaken by a participant in order to receive assistance under these programs including the reports that are filed by program participants with the Foreign Agricultural Service (FAS). 
 
The commodity procurement regulations at 7 CFR part 1496 which are used to obtain commodities under these programs would be deleted and republished, with minor revisions, in the Agriculture Acquisition Regulation (AGAR) in chapter 4 of title 48 of the Code of Federal Regulations.  The AGAR would also be amended to specify the criteria used in determining whether a purchased commodity is solely a product of the United States.  The criteria would be applicable to commodities procured under international and domestic feeding programs administered by USDA.]]></ABSTRACT>
